- Read actively: As you read the passage, actively engage with the text by underlining key terms, identifying the author's tone, and making connections to your own experiences or prior knowledge.
- Understand the context: Make sure you understand the historical, social, or cultural context in which the passage is written. This will help you better grasp the author's arguments and intentions.
- Focus on keywords: Pay attention to keywords related to TCKs, such as "expatriate," "globalization," "cultural identity," and "adaptation." These terms can help you identify the main ideas and supporting details.
- Practice inference and implication: IELTS reading passages often require test-takers to make inferences or understand implied meaning. When reading about TCKs, consider the author's perspective, potential biases, and unstated assumptions.
